Ivan is a graduate from the Dual J.D. Program at the University of Windsor Faculty of Law and the University of Detroit Mercy School of Law. During his time in law school, he placed as a finalist in both the 2017 Zuber Moot Competition and the 2017 Hicks Morley Moot Competition at Windsor Law. In the summer of 2018, Ivan worked as a Student Attorney at the United Community Housing Coalition in Detroit, Michigan, where he represented tenants in need facing eviction proceedings. He was called to the Ontario Bar in June 2020.

Prior to law school, he worked at a downtown Toronto law firm as a Legal Intern. Ivan holds an Honours Bachelor of Arts, with a Major in Ethics, Society, and Law and a Double Minor in English and Russian Literature from the University of Toronto.

Ivan is a volunteer at Lawyers Feed the Hungry in Timmins. In his spare time, Ivan writes poetry and fiction. He won the second-place prize in the OSSTF Marion Drysdale Poetry Contest. He is also an avid mountain biker. Ivan is fluent in Bulgarian.”

Ivan will be practicing in the areas of family law, real estate, employment law and civil litigation.
